WebTo calculate the average of values in cells B2, B3, B4, and B5 enter: =AVERAGE(B2:B5) This can be typed directly into the cell or formula bar, or selected on the worksheet by selecting the first cell in the range, and dragging the mouse to the last cell in the range. The following formula contains two non contiguous cell ranges B3:B8 and D3:D4, the AVERAGE function ignores blank cells automatically.
